Output fb83fd6ae5a64e9cee302f58cc037908ae81b75af20e573db228fe2146aa169e:13

value
1387000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50ba59cd58217d0efbf8e463751c81c601fbb591 OP_EQUAL
address
393sDmcfAHtBoNysHRQz9aiJX8MKXD9Hyt
transaction
fb83fd6ae5a64e9cee302f58cc037908ae81b75af20e573db228fe2146aa169e
spent
true